| Royster v Breakwaters Townhomes Assn. of Buffalo, Inc. |
| 2022 NY Slip Op 00590 [201 AD3d 1352] |
| January 28, 2022 |
| Appellate Division, Fourth Department |
| Published by New York State Law Reporting Bureau pursuant to Judiciary Law § 431. |
| Michael Royster, Respondent, v Breakwaters Townhomes Association of Buffalo, Inc., Appellant. (Appeal No. 1.) |
Pillinger Miller Tarallo, LLP, Syracuse (Jacqueline R. Garren of counsel), for defendant-appellant.
Marsh Ziller LLP, Buffalo (Linda Marsh of counsel), for plaintiff-respondent.
Appeal from an order of the Supreme Court, Erie County (Mark A. Montour, J.), entered October 20, 2020. The order denied defendant's motion for leave to file its jury demand nunc pro tunc.
Now, upon reading and filing the stipulation of discontinuance signed by the attorneys for the parties on December 17, 2021,
It is hereby ordered that said appeal is unanimously dismissed without costs upon stipulation. Present—Peradotto, J.P., Carni, Lindley, Curran and Bannister, JJ.
